• How can I create a multisite WordPress website in one dashboard so that I can easily manage for installing plugin and themes and go others domain dashboard without login again?

    I want to set up my 3 domains such as domain1.com, domain2.com domain3.com.

    Please tell me if it is possible to set up this type of network with domain( without creating subdomain or subdirectory).

    If it’s possible to let me suggest the plugins.

  • If you want to have a multisite of top-level domains, this will still require subdomains/subdirectories for the TLDs to map to.

    I would recommend you to install the most popular WP multi-site management tool – the ManageWp Plugin
    It will be the perfect choice for your situation. This plugin enables WordPress admins to connect different installations and thus they can manage them from 1 dashboard very easily. You need to install the plugin on one site which is going to be your “main site” and then you can install the ManageWP on as many “children” sites as you want.
